Summary: Individuals in the position are responsible for assisting Tropical Financial Credit Union in the achievement of its purpose of guiding members successfully through the financial marketplace. The MSR position is responsible for providing world-class member-focused service via inbound and outbound telephone calls. The MSR provides information to members/potential members accurately and efficiently, promptly and consistently answers questions and inquiries, troubleshoot problems, assist with concerns, cross-sells products, and services and refers lending products to include mortgage and consumer loans.

JOB SPECIFIC DUTIES

CUSTOMER SERVICE / SALES:

  • Assists the Members in identifying and resolving account issues.
  • Cross-sells Credit Union products and services.
  • Provide service that meets the TFCU Service Standards as measured by the responses of member surveys; meet or exceed established call response and quality goals.
  • Support and provide world-class service via multiple communication methods, including telephone, fax, or email as a receiver and caller.
  • Use questioning and listening skills that support effective and positive telephone communication.
  • Use a practical and professional approach to handle individual telephone tasks like call transfer, taking messages, call backs, holds, interruptions, and unintentional disconnects.
  • Must be able to conduct cashless teller transactions such as transfers of funds between accounts, withdrawals, loan payments, etc.
  • Understands the impact of ensuring a professional and positive attitude in handling calls efficiently.
  • Effectively deals with job stress, angry or upset members.
  • Effectively adapts communication and behavior style to communicate with the members.
  • Apply the elements of building positive rapport with different types of members over the phone.
  • Apply the proper telephone etiquette to satisfy various member situations.
  • Apply appropriate actions to control a telephone call effectively.
  • Identify voice skills and tones to enhance and provide an excellent telephone presentation.
  • Meets commitments to members by contacting them promptly to follow up on pending items or requests.
  • Assist with sales calls for related to deposit or loan business and must be able to quotes current account information and rates.
  • Must be flexible with their work schedule as work requirements may change.
  • Meet or exceed all goals as defined in the individual’s performance appraisal.
  • Must meet or exceed the mortgage and consumer loan referral goals

  • BSA Compliance: every employee is required to uphold the credit union’s compliance with the Bank Secrecy Act and anti-money laundering policies and procedures. Specific functions within TFCU will take into consideration the awareness of unusual or suspicious activity that is relevant to the department.
  • In addition to any other assigned training courses, online BSA and OFAC courses must be completed at least annually, as made available by the Training and Compliance Departments.
  • Ensure ongoing individual compliance with all regulatory requirements established in the SAFE Act, if required.
  • Maintains comprehensive knowledge of the Bank Secrecy Act, Customer Identification Program, USA Patriot Act, OFAC, Fair Lending, and Credit Card Act.
